Hello everyone and I apologize for being late with the match summary of Chennai Super Kings v/s Sunrisers Hyderabad, the 23rd match of IPL 2021. But better late than never, so here it is. The match was played at the Feroz Shah Kotla stadium in Delhi. David Warner won the toss and decided to bat first and MS Dhoni was happy to bowl first at the surface where we predicted something for the bowlers in the first inning and expected dew to play a role in the second inning. David Warner and Johnny Bairstow opened for Hyderabad but Bairstow was dismissed early for 7 runs by Sam Curran. Manish Pandey and Warner played well for the second wicket and built a strong partnership together but Warner struggled to play his shots. He couldn't score at a quick run rate as many of his well-timed shots went straight to the fielders. Hello everyone and thank you for joining again for another match summary. The 22nd match was played between Royal Challengers Bangalore and Delhi Capitals at Narendra Modi stadium. Delhi won the toss and decided to bowl first and they would have expected dew to come down just like the match the day before but there was no dew in this game and Bangalore held their nerves well as the match went to the last ball and they won by 1 run. Virat Kohli and Devdutt Paddikal opened the inning for Bangalore and the two made 25 runs in 3 overs. But Avesh Khan bowled Kohli on the last ball of the 4th over and Kohli went back after making 12 runs. Ishant Sharma bowled Paddikal on the first ball of the 5th over and Paddikal went back after making 17 runs. Glenn Maxwell hit a few boundaries and looked good but was dismissed on 25 runs. Hello everyone and thank you for coming to read the match summary of match 21 of the IPL 2021. Punjab Kings and Kolkata Knight Riders played this match on the Narendra Modi stadium and Kolkata won the lucky toss and they decided to bowl first. Kolkata went with an unchanged team while Punjab made just one change and brought in Chris Jordan on Fabian Allen's place. The match was a low scoring one and Kolkata got a much-needed victory at the end.  KL Rahul and Mayank Agarwal opened the batting for Punjab and they couldn't score freely in the power play overs. KL was dismissed in the 6th over on 19 runs but Punjab had just 36 runs on the board at that stage. Mayank played 34 balls but scored only 31 runs and was dismissed by Sunil Narine. Chris Gayle and Deepak Hooda got out cheaply and Punjab was 4 wickets down on 60 runs in the 12th over. Hello everyone and thank you for coming to read the summary of match 18 of the IPL 2021 that was played between Rajasthan Royals and Kolkata Knight Riders. Both the teams needed a win desperately and Rajasthan won this match to win after 2 consecutive losses. For Kolkata, it was their 4th consecutive loss. And the team looks in a very bad state. Talking from the beginning, Rajasthan won the toss and asked Kolkata to bat first at the Wankhede stadium. Shubhman Gill and Nitish Rana opened the inning for Kolkata and they got the worst start they could have dreamed of. Neither of the two openers could get going at any stage of the game and they struggled to time the ball. Shubhman Gill was run-out in the 6th over and he made just 11 runs in 19 balls. Kolkata was at 24 runs at that stage. Nitish Rana got out in the 9th over and he made 22 runs in 25 runs. Kolkata had 45 runs on board then. And Kolkata never recovered from there. Hello everyone. Let's talk about the match that was played between Royal Challengers Bangalore and Rajasthan Royals. The match was played at Wankhede stadium and the toss went in Bangalore's favour and they decided to bowl first. The match proved to be one-sided at the end as Bangalore cruised to victory by 10 wickets.  Jos Buttler and Manan Vohra opened for Rajasthan in the first inning and Buttler was sent back by Mohammad Siraj in the 3rd over of the match. He played a bad shot and missed the ball completely and was bowled by Siraj on 8 runs. Manan Vohra followed his partner to the dressing room after scoring 7 runs as he was dismissed by Kyle Jamieson in the 4th over. David Miller was dismissed leg before by Siraj for a duck. Sanju Samson got a start but couldn't make it big yet again and got out on 21 runs in the 8th over. Rajasthan had lost 4 wickets for 43 runs at that stage. Hello everyone once again. Let's talk about the match 13 of the tournament that was played between Mumbai Indians and Delhi Capitals. Both teams had won their last matches and wanted to continue the winning spree but only one of them managed that after this match and it was the Delhi Capitals.  Rohit Sharma won the toss at the MA Chidambaram stadium and decided to bat first. He and Quinton de Cock opened the batting for Mumbai. But Quinton was dismissed on 2 runs by Marcus Stoinis in the 3rd over of the match. Suryakumar Yadav came in next and started playing his shots. Rohit too looked in good touch and was hitting his shots well. But both the batsmen were dismissed just when they looked set to go big. Mumbai had gotten a good start with 55 runs in the first 6 overs, but once Surya and Rohit got down, the match started turning in Delhi's favour.
